#include "pch.h" /** Takes data, allocate a buffer in heap of size 4/3 + 2 to handle the result, base64 encode it and returns a pointer to result buffer. @param const unsigned char* data The data to be encoded. @param unsigned short input_length Length of unencoded data (length of previous arg) @param unsigned short input_length An address to handle the length of b64 encoded result data. Will be 4/3 + 2 of input_length @return char* A pointer to the heap buffer containing the b64 encoded result */ char* base64_encode(const unsigned char* data, unsigned short input_length, unsigned short* output_length) { char* encoded_data = NULL; DWORD local_output_len = 0; if (!CryptBinaryToStringA ( data, input_length, CRYPT_STRING_BASE64 | CRYPT_STRING_NOCRLF, NULL, &local_output_len )) { return NULL; } encoded_data = (char*)calloc(local_output_len, sizeof(char)); if (!encoded_data) { return NULL; } if (!CryptBinaryToStringA ( data, input_length, CRYPT_STRING_BASE64 | CRYPT_STRING_NOCRLF, encoded_data, &local_output_len )) { return NULL; } if (local_output_len <= 65535) { *output_length = (unsigned short)local_output_len; } else return NULL; return encoded_data; } /** Builds a decoding table in heap. Then takes base 64 encoded data data, allocate a buffer in heap of size 3/4 of input length to handle the result, base64 decode it and returns a pointer to the result buffer. Then, free the base64 decoding table. @param const unsigned char* data The data to be decoded. @param unsigned short input_length Length of encoded data (length of previous arg) @param unsigned short input_length An address to handle the length of b64 encoded result data. Will be 3/4 of input_length @return char* A pointer to the heap buffer containing the decoded result */ unsigned char* base64_decode(const char* data, unsigned short input_length, unsigned short* output_length) { unsigned char* decoded_data = NULL; DWORD local_output_len = 0; if (!CryptStringToBinaryA ( data, 0, CRYPT_STRING_BASE64, NULL, &local_output_len, NULL, NULL )) { return NULL; } decoded_data = (unsigned char*)calloc(local_output_len, sizeof(char)); if (!decoded_data) { return NULL; } if (!CryptStringToBinaryA ( data, 0, CRYPT_STRING_BASE64, decoded_data, &local_output_len, NULL, NULL )) { return NULL; } if (local_output_len <= 65535) { *output_length = (unsigned short)local_output_len; } else return NULL; return decoded_data; }
